Painting concrete cellar floors. Some of the materials used for this project require special masks and other equipment due to fumes. When painting your concrete basement floor safety is important. Test the humidity in your basement by taping a piece of plastic onto the floor and letting it sit for 24 hours. Concrete paint can be purchased in either latex or oil based epoxy enamel.

Using an epoxy floor paint consists of painting on a primer then a color base coat and finishing with a clear top coat. Many basement flooring materials like paint epoxy tile and rubber flooring for example can go down directly over the basement s original poured concrete floor as long as the concrete is in good condition. If your floor shows any signs of water seepage the source of the water must be eliminated before starting. A 2 part water based system would work just fine on a basement floor.
